Testing Down, Positive Cases Up In Latest Dearborn Co. Morbidity & Mortality Report

The Dearborn County Health Department continues to keep community members informed with their weekly report.

(Lawrenceburg, Ind.) - The Dearborn County Health Department is continuing to keep community members informed with their weekly Morbidity and Mortality Report.

For the week of September 11-16, a total of 338 Dearborn County residents were tested for COVID-19.

Of those tested, there were 321 negative tests and 17 positive tests.  

Testing was down from 421 a week prior and positive tests increased by two.

Five individuals ages 19-30 tested positive for the virus, the most of any age group between September 11-16.

There were no COVID-related deaths in the county for the fifth consecutive week.

To date, Dearborn County has reported 614 positive cases and 28 deaths.
